在這個(gè)例子中,當(dāng)改變picker值的時(shí)候,Cell中的值也跟著改變。以前就一直很糾結(jié)怎么獲取選中的Cell,看過(guò)這個(gè)例子后,真是豁然開(kāi)朗呀! 這個(gè)例子里用到了一個(gè)方法:indexPathForSelectedRow,用這個(gè)方法就能獲取選擇的cell了--!以前怎么沒(méi)發(fā)現(xiàn)... 關(guān)鍵代碼: - (IBAction)dateAction:(id)sender{
[self.tableView
補(bǔ)充問(wèn)題:以上方法只有在點(diǎn)擊cell時(shí)才能確定cell的index,而如果點(diǎn)擊了cell上的button,用上面的方法還是沒(méi)辦法解決。 解決辦法:由按鈕獲得它SuperView,即你自己定義的cell,知道這個(gè)cell了后在得到它的行數(shù)。 |
|